A group of Palestinian hackers claimed Thursday to have leaked the credit card information of 26,000 Israelis. An analysis of the list, however, revealed that many of the details are false, partial or flawed.
The list was apparently stolen from the database of a small commercial website.

The group, which calls itself "OpFreePalestine" said that "Israel is committing genocide, killing babies and committing all kinds of murder since 1948. And its citizens are funding these acts." The group urged a "digital intifada" against Israel.
Israeli hacker group ZionOps, which analyzed the data, said that a large part of the list was simply copied off the list leaked in January by Saudi hacker 0xOmar.
